Police in Budaka district say they have arrested a 23-year-old student nurse after he was caught attempting to steal government drugs from Budaka Health Centre IV.
The suspect, Sadik Sabali, was intercepted by a vigilant night watchman while leaving the general ward with nine vials of artesunate injections, commonly used to treat severe malaria.
Bukedi North Police region spokesperson Wilfred Kyempasa said the suspect had previously interned at the facility, giving him access to restricted areas.
The drugs, valued at shillings 46,000, were recovered and recorded as exhibits. Police say investigations are nearly complete, and the file is due for submission to the Resident State Attorney for sanctioning.
The theft of government drugs is a big and persistent problem in Uganda's healthcare system.
According to the National Drug Authority, stolen government drugs worth over 13 billion shillings have been recovered since 2019, and over 60 individuals have been arrested. Out of these are 44 government health workers.
